Output 34959415f7389fdd8d7ae2598fd8dfbe0a6a005de73c4a81a0ad752dddf4aea5:20
- value
- 586866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 082d22a235ad92a1c0720ad549ff71574de87886 OP_EQUAL
- address
- 32SFQ8gCmK3vVETDELXs339tspbKG55tZg
- transaction
- 34959415f7389fdd8d7ae2598fd8dfbe0a6a005de73c4a81a0ad752dddf4aea5